Available as an electronic download, this full version of IK Multimedia MODO BASS is a physically modeled electric bass virtual instrument that lets you create realistic performances infused with the unique tonal properties that come from the construction and components of the bass, combined with player technique, finesse, and ever-changing dynamic interactions between the two.

Unlike sample-based instruments, MODO BASS uses modal synthesis technology to recreate the physical properties of a real electric bass that is being played. This allows you to experiment in real time with 14 iconic bass models, customizable string properties, and 24 interchangeable pickups. Furthermore, the Play Style function lets you choose and modify how you approach and play the instrument by modelling the way you use your hand and where you play on the string, with options such as finger, slap/pull, pick, and mute.The software comes with an Amp/FX section that offers a choice of tube amp or solid-state amp and seven stompbox effects, adding another layer of realism to your sound. The MODO BASS can function as a standalone or as a plug-in instrument.

Dynamic Response through Sponge & Sag

The amplifier/cabinet combinations in AmpliTube MAX utilize Sponge and Sag processing to replicate in a more faithful manner the dynamic interaction between the power amp and the speakers, aiming to eliminate the harshness found in the upper frequencies of other software

Acoustic Simulator

AmpliTube MAX features an Acoustic Sim pedal that aims to transmute your electric guitar into an acoustic; it is tweakable with onboard controls and features three styles of acoustic body and body tops

Effects Loop Stage

AmpliTube MAX has a slot in the signal chain right after the preamp section but before the power stage; this slot lets you add in up to four daisy-chained effects (including all of the stompboxes) for signal processing before hitting the power section

Available for download, Lurssen Mastering Console from IK Multimedia is mastering software that can be used in standalone applications, on your Mac or Windows computer, or within iOS devices. It’s capable of handling 88.2 and 96 kHz signals, while its processors have been modeled on the hardware utilized at the Grammy Award-Winning studios of Gavin Lurssen; as such, the software offers a simplified user experience with much in the way of signal manipulation going on behind the GUI.

Its basic ethos is this: when mastering, Gavin Lurssen uses a set series of hardware modules determined by the genre of the material. Likewise, the modules available in the Lurssen Mastering Console change depending on the preset style you choose to work from. A hip-hop setting might put the limiter in a different chain position than the pop setting, for example, and each individual processor is interdependent—touch one knob, and everything else is as affected. Whichever preset you choose, you are always given control over input drive, a five-band EQ, a push setting (which juices the inter-relationship between all modules at once), as well as full automation over peak level.

One of the most interesting facets of the Lurssen Mastering Console is the ability to go between computer platforms and iOS devices. In conjunction with the mobile app, you can now do more than listen to your master in the car between mastering sessions—you can actually tweak your master in the vehicle (not while driving, of course), and take the resulting mix back to your studio in order to see if the results translate to all the speakers therein.
